A guy local to me had planned on stating his own RTT company (HAUS), but then COVID happened. He found the manufacturer for CVT/Roofnest aluminum cased RTTs and designed this one. It came with the 4Runner we just purchased, and it's too small for us. Here are the specs:
Interior: 82"x48"
Exterior: 85"x51"x6.29" (without the added rack/rails) (SUPER low profile)
Weight: 137 lbs
Tested weight support is 720 lbs

Includes a 2/3 roof rack and two cross bars. This tent is made with the nice, thick (I think waxed) canvas. It has a 4" thick memory foam mattress inside. Comes with a ladder. It also has mounting channels all around the bottom perimeter for stuff like lights. The lights you see in the photos are NOT included with the tent. This is only the tent, cross bars, and 2/3 rack.

This tent has been used less than 5 times. It smells and looks brand new.
